An obstruction in your drain system may be caused by wide variety of reasons and products such as hair, grease and food could clog up the pipework in both your household or perhaps the drains outside. More often than not you’ll need to hire a professional to sort out the issue. Right now these problems could be dealt with in several ways dependant upon the extent of the obstruction. Some of the widely used ways of getting rid of a blockage include chemical cleaners and air burst equipment. The aforementioned are best for lesser blockages however when it comes to removing debris and obstructions in a bigger area you could need a sewer jet or electric drain cleaner. These have to be used by professionals exclusively. Leominster is a market town in the English county of Herefordshire. It is located at the confluence of the River Lugg and its tributary the River Kenwater, roughly 12 miles (19 km) north of the city of Hereford and about 7 miles south of the Shropshire border, 11 miles from Ludlow in Shropshire. Leominster railway station has services to Manchester, going through Ludlow and Cardiff, and links to London are achieved by changing at Hereford. With a permanent population of roughly 11691 people, according to the 2011 Census, Leominster is the largest of the five towns Leominster, Ross-on-Wye, Ledbury, Bromyard and Kington in the county encompassing the City of Hereford. From 1974 to 1996, Leominster served as the administrative centre for the previous regional government district of Leominster District. The town takes its name from a minster, which is a group of clergy in the district of Lene or Leon. Throughout the Early Middle Ages, Leominster was the home of Æthelmod of Leominster, an English saint known to history commonly through the hagiography of the Secgan Manuscript. He is said to be buried in Leominster. Leominster is also the historic birthplace of Ryeland sheep, a species previously known for its ‘Lemster’ wool, named ‘Lemster ore’. This wool was cherished above all other English wool in trade with the continent of Europe in the Middle Ages. It was the profit and affluence from this wool trade that developed the town and the minster and tempted the envy of the Welsh and other regions.
